We are looking for a Senior Lecturer to join our Psychology department. This is to fill the position of Programme convener (Course Leader) for our new MA Integrative Counselling & Psychotherapy for Children, Adolescents and Families.
The post holder should be a qualified and registered practitioner (BACP, UKCP, ACP etc.) with considerable academic experience. The post holder will take responsibility for the organization and running of this new programme. The programme is underpinned by Attachment Theory and incorporates an integration of a Child Centred, Psychodynamic and Systemic approaches together with a focus on CBT.
Accordingly we are seeking to appoint an individual with expertise (including research) in one or more of these areas.
